The hallowed vest

The hallowed vest

To reach toward the pyramid
Atop the burning light
E’er thrust and run and tally –
The trepid traveller’s flight

To be void of divinity –
Subtracted from the sun
Brightness dwindles as time allows
And peddles thoughts still young

Sounding like an orchestra –
The music sung by one
Though whispering – a baritone
Transcends the gathered throng

Who listen to the music
As if they hear Him come
Waiting the day the christened ground - 
Its ingress shared with some

Relieve one of their wherewithal
Comparison attests
The one atop the pyramid
Wears the hallowed vest.
